Opendefecation, E. Colicontamination, Sosialization, and Behavior Change of the People of Sumur Batu Village, Babakan Madang Subdistrict, Bogor District

Result study in Sumur Batu Village in 2017 discovered that open defecation (OD) contributesto E.coli contamination in water flow at RW 04 Sumur Batu Village. The amount of people that has septic tank is expected having contribution to the contamination. From 10 water samples taken, show that the level of contaminant is exceeding the standard thus risking health. The increases of activity such as public bathing, washing and toilet facilities on the upstream and downstream and also feces final disposal on watershed/ river basin, raise the risk of contamination of water flow in Sumur Batu Village.

In general, the program that will be conducted is the effort to organize, to maintain the environment, to analyze needs, and to increase the knowledge. With this activity, community is expected having concern to their health and environment. The aim of this community service is increasing people’s knowledge about the effect of open defecation, healthy latrine and the benefits of its use, related diseases, and then the behavior change and decreases in the incidence of the diseases.

From the results of activities before and after the intervention it was known that knowledge and attitudes increased from 37,5% to 54,3% and 53,1% to 78,6%, but not with behavior (from 53,1% to 37,1%).
